Hi Paul,

Mariane seems to be the couple's first child born in Ydby. The birth place info for Dorthe Iversdatter in the censuses must be wrong, so I started looking for Mariane's sister Ane instead.

In the censuses 1845-1860 for Ydby parish her birth place is recorded as Thisted, e.g.

Thisted, Refs, Ydby, Ydby by, Et huus, 38.1, FT-1860, D5129
Name:    Age:    Marital status:      Position in household:      Occupation:      Birth place:
Ane Iversdatter    65    Enke    Spinderske, huuseier       Thisted

And indeed, I found a daughter Ane born to Iver Christensen and wife Kiersten Jensdatter Balsbye on 15 May 1796 (Thisted, Hundborg, Thisted 1765-1807, opslag 321, No 17). She was baptized 12 Jun.

Dorthe is in the same church book, opslag 278-279, No 26, born 4 Jul. 1793.
Christen is on opslag 349, No 38 - born 7 Sep. 1798.

Iver Christensen and Kiersten Jensdatter of Thisted were betrothed 12 Oct. 1792 and married 22 Nov. (same church book, opslag 531, No 6). One of the sponsors is here:

Thisted, Hundborg, Thisted Købstad, Vestergade, No. 9, 8, FT-1787, B1185
Name:    Age:    Marital status:      Position in household:      Occupation:
Henrich Knachergaard    37    Ugift    hosbonde    kræmer    
Anne Knachergaard    38    Ugift    hosbondens søster       
Giertrud Marie Knachergaard    31    Ugift    hosbondens søster       
Christen Knachergaard    30    Ugift    hosbondens farbroder søn    kræmer

He cannot be Iver's father. The other is Rasmus Nielsen of Thisted, whom I cannot identify

Could it be the Iver Christensen mentioned in https://www.slaegtogdata.dk/forum/index.php/topic,73786.0.html  ?

I checked the 1787 census for Thisted, and the transcription looks ok, but the age could be wrong in the original census:
http://www.sa.dk/ao/billedviser?bsid=1344#1344,63864

At his death in June 1838 he is said to be 65 years old, his father Ch Andersen, Aulsmand in Thisted.

Hi Paul,

You're welcome. I've seen you struggle to find this family.

I found Iver Christensen's confirmation 19 Apr. 1789 in Thisted 1765-1807, opslag 424, No 2,
15 years old. He would have been a young groom in Nov. 1792, but not impossible.

The sponsors are here in the 1801 census:

Thisted, Hundborg, Thisted Købstad, Thisted Kiøbstad, Nørre Gade 82, 2, FT-1801, B9218
Name:    Age:    Marital status:      Position in household:      Occupation:      
Christen Knakkergaard    43    Gift    Huusbonde    Kiøbmand og Kiæmner    
Kiersten Andersdatter    62    Gift    Hans Kone   [could be related to Aulsmand Christen Andersen]      
Niels Thousgaard    33    Ugift    Tieneste Folk       
Peder Larsen    35    Ugift    Tieneste Folk       
Jens Smed    17    Ugift    Tieneste Folk       
Marie Rønberg    19    Ugift    Tieneste Folk       
Mette Catrine Pedersdatter    34    Ugift    Tieneste Folk

Thisted, Hundborg, Thisted Købstad, Thisted Kiøbstad, Store Gade 37, 29, FT-1801, B9218
Name:    Age:    Marital status:      Position in household:      Occupation:      
Rasmus Nielsen    35    Gift    Huusfader    Fuldmægtig paa Amtstuen    
Abelone Christine fød With    29    Gift    Hans Kone       
Birthe Andersdatter    30    Ugift    Tienestepige

Next you should try to identify the witnesses at the baptisms in Thisted and Ydby.

The mother of the children is Kirsten Jensdatter Balsbye. There may be a connection to this family,
which would also explain why the family moved from Thisted to Ydby:

Thisted, Refs, Hurup, Hurup Bye, ingen, 10, FT-1801, B4256
Name:    Age:    Marital status:      Position in household:      Occupation:   
Claus Jensen Balsbye    55    Gift    huusbonde    bonde og gaardbeboer    
Helvig Jensdatter    57    Gift    hans kone       
Ane Cathrine Clausdatter    24    Ugift    deres barn       
Niels Christian -    22    Ugift    deres barn       
Jens Mathis -    16    Ugift    deres barn

What makes it difficult is that the name Balsbye is not always used, as we've seen for Kirsten Jensdatter.
At Mariane's baptism there are two Mads Jensen among the witnesses. Unfortunately I'm not able to read
the byname/place name.
